域名解析dns 是什么意思

域名解析DNS是将易于记忆的域名转换为IP地址的过程,使得用户可以通过输入网址访问网站。DNS系统如同互联网的电话簿,确保浏览器快速找到对应的服务器,提升用户体验。

imagesource from: pexels

域名解析DNS:互联网的隐形导航

在互联网的浩瀚海洋中,域名解析DNS扮演着至关重要的角色。想象一下,如果没有电话簿,我们如何在成千上万的号码中找到朋友的联系方式?同样地,DNS就像是互联网的电话簿,将我们熟知的域名(如www.example.com)转换为复杂的IP地址(如192.0.2.1),使得浏览器能够快速找到对应的服务器。这一过程看似简单,却直接影响着我们的上网体验。本文将深入探讨DNS的工作原理,揭示其对用户体验的深远影响,带你一窥互联网背后的隐形导航系统。

一、域名解析DNS的基本概念

1、域名的定义与作用

域名是互联网上用于识别特定网站的字符组合,如“www.example.com”。它相当于网站的“门牌号”,方便用户记忆和访问。域名由多个部分组成,包括顶级域名(如.com、.net)、二级域名(如example)等。域名的存在极大地简化了互联网的使用,使得用户无需记住复杂的IP地址,只需输入易于记忆的域名即可访问网站。

2、IP地址的简介

IP地址是网络中设备的唯一标识,类似于现实生活中的电话号码。它由一系列数字组成,如“192.168.1.1”。IP地址分为IPv4和IPv6两种格式,前者由四组数字组成,每组0-255之间;后者则更为复杂,能够提供更多的地址空间。IP地址确保数据在网络中准确传输,是互联网通信的基础。

3、DNS的功能与重要性

DNS(Domain Name System,域名系统)的主要功能是将易于记忆的域名转换为对应的IP地址。这个过程被称为“域名解析”。DNS系统由多个层次的服务器组成,包括根域名服务器、顶级域名服务器和权威域名服务器。当用户在浏览器中输入域名时,DNS系统会逐级查询,最终返回对应的IP地址,使浏览器能够连接到目标服务器。

DNS的重要性不言而喻。首先,它简化了用户的上网过程,无需记住复杂的IP地址。其次,DNS提高了网络的访问效率,通过缓存机制减少解析时间。最后,DNS的安全性直接影响到用户的上网安全,防止DNS劫持等恶意攻击。可以说,DNS是互联网正常运行的基石,对用户体验有着深远的影响。

通过了解域名、IP地址和DNS的基本概念,我们为深入探讨DNS的工作原理及其对用户体验的影响奠定了基础。接下来,我们将详细解析DNS的工作过程,揭示这一幕后英雄的运作机制。

二、DNS的工作原理详解

1. DNS解析的过程步骤

DNS解析是一个复杂但高效的过程,它确保用户输入的域名能够快速转换为对应的IP地址。整个过程大致分为以下四步:

  1. 用户查询:当用户在浏览器中输入一个域名(如www.example.com)时,DNS解析的第一步便开始了。
  2. 本地DNS服务器查询:用户的请求首先发送到本地DNS服务器(通常由ISP提供),本地DNS服务器会检查其缓存中是否有该域名的记录。
  3. 根域名服务器查询:如果本地DNS服务器没有缓存记录,请求将发送到根域名服务器。根域名服务器不直接提供IP地址,而是指向相应的顶级域名服务器。
  4. 顶级域名服务器与权威域名服务器查询:根域名服务器将请求转发到顶级域名服务器(如.com、.org等),再由顶级域名服务器指向权威域名服务器。权威域名服务器最终提供该域名的IP地址。

2. 根域名服务器的作用

根域名服务器是DNS解析的“起点”,全球共有13组根域名服务器,它们负责管理顶级域名的解析。虽然数量看似不多,但通过分布式架构和缓存机制,根域名服务器能够高效处理全球范围内的DNS查询请求。

3. 顶级域名服务器与权威域名服务器

顶级域名服务器负责管理特定顶级域(如.com、.net等)的DNS解析。当请求到达顶级域名服务器后,它会将请求转发到相应的权威域名服务器。权威域名服务器存储了具体域名的IP地址信息,是DNS解析的最终环节。

4. DNS缓存机制

DNS缓存机制是提升DNS解析速度的关键。各级DNS服务器(包括本地DNS服务器、根域名服务器等)都会缓存已解析的域名信息。当再次收到相同域名的查询请求时,服务器可以直接从缓存中获取IP地址,避免了重复的解析过程,显著提升了响应速度。

通过以上步骤,DNS系统高效地将域名转换为IP地址,确保用户能够快速访问目标网站。理解DNS的工作原理,不仅有助于优化网络设置,还能更好地应对DNS相关的问题,提升用户体验。

三、DNS对用户体验的影响

在互联网世界中,DNS(域名系统)不仅仅是一个幕后英雄,更是直接影响用户体验的关键因素。以下是DNS在提升用户体验方面的几个重要方面:

1. 快速解析提升访问速度

DNS解析的速度直接决定了用户访问网站的快慢。当用户在浏览器中输入一个域名时,DNS需要迅速将这个域名解析为对应的IP地址。一个高效的DNS解析过程可以显著减少等待时间,使得网页加载速度更快。研究表明,网页加载时间每增加1秒,用户流失率就会增加7%。因此,优化DNS解析速度是提升用户体验的首要任务。

2. DNS安全性与稳定性

DNS的安全性同样不容忽视。DNS劫持、DNS欺骗等安全问题会导致用户被误导至恶意网站,甚至泄露个人信息。一个稳定且安全的DNS服务能够有效防止这些风险,保障用户的网络安全。此外,DNS的稳定性也直接影响到网站的可用性。频繁的DNS故障会导致网站无法访问,严重影响用户体验。

3. DNS优化策略

为了进一步提升用户体验,采取一些DNS优化策略是非常必要的。首先,使用可靠的DNS服务商可以确保解析的稳定性和速度。其次,合理配置DNS缓存机制,可以减少重复解析的时间。此外,采用DNS负载均衡技术,可以根据用户地理位置选择最优的服务器,进一步提升访问速度。

通过以上措施,DNS不仅能够确保用户快速、安全地访问网站,还能在无形中提升用户的整体网络体验。可以说,DNS是互联网世界中不可或缺的“隐形助手”,其优化与否直接关系到用户的满意度和网站的竞争力。

结语:掌握DNS,畅游互联网

在互联网的世界里,DNS如同一位默默无闻的导航员,将复杂的IP地址转化为我们熟悉的域名,确保每一次网络访问都能迅速、准确地到达目的地。理解DNS的工作原理及其重要性,不仅有助于我们更好地使用网络,还能在实际应用中通过优化DNS设置,显著提升访问速度和安全性。因此,掌握DNS知识,无疑是畅游互联网的必备技能。让我们一起行动起来,优化DNS配置,享受更高效、更安全的网络体验吧!

常见问题

1、DNS解析失败怎么办?

DNS解析失败可能导致网站无法访问,常见原因包括DNS服务器故障、网络连接问题或配置错误。解决方法如下:首先,检查网络连接是否正常;其次,尝试更换DNS服务器,如使用谷歌的8.8.8.8或阿里的223.5.5.5;最后,清除浏览器缓存或重启路由器。若问题依旧,建议联系网络服务提供商。

2、如何查看和修改DNS设置?

查看和修改DNS设置方法因操作系统而异。在Windows系统中,打开“控制面板”选择“网络和共享中心”,点击“更改适配器设置”,右键网络连接选择“属性”,找到“Internet协议版本4 (TCP/IPv4)”并点击“属性”,即可查看和修改DNS服务器地址。在macOS中,进入“系统偏好设置”选择“网络”,选择相应网络连接,点击“高级”,切换到“DNS”标签页进行操作。

3、DNS劫持是什么?如何防范?

DNS劫持是指攻击者篡改DNS解析结果,将用户导向恶意网站。防范措施包括:使用可靠的DNS服务器,如谷歌DNS或Cloudflare DNS;安装网络安全软件,定期更新系统补丁;使用HTTPS协议访问网站,增加安全性;若发现异常,及时检查并修改DNS设置。

4、公共DNS和私有DNS的区别是什么?

公共DNS面向所有用户开放,如谷歌DNS、Cloudflare DNS等,具有广泛覆盖性和高可靠性,但可能存在隐私泄露风险。私有DNS通常由企业或组织内部搭建,仅供内部使用,安全性更高,但覆盖范围有限。选择时,需根据实际需求和安全性考虑。公共DNS适合普通用户,私有DNS更适合对安全性要求高的企业。

原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/32738.html

Like (0)
路飞练拳的地方的头像路飞练拳的地方研究员
Previous 2025-06-08 11:27
Next 2025-06-08 11:28

相关推荐

  • 网址收录如何提高

    提高网址收录的关键在于优化网站结构和内容。首先,确保网站有清晰的导航和合理的URL结构。其次,定期发布高质量、原创的内容,并合理使用关键词。最后,利用sitemap和robots.txt文件帮助搜索引擎更好地抓取网站内容。同时,建立高质量的外部链接也能有效提升收录率。

    2025-06-13
    0251
  • 留言功能要多久

    留言功能的开发时间因网站类型和开发团队的技术水平而异。通常,基础留言功能可能只需几天即可完成,而复杂的功能如审核机制、用户权限管理等则可能需要几周。建议明确需求并与开发团队充分沟通,以获得准确的开发时间预估。

    2025-06-11
    0278
  • 为什么要设计代码

    设计代码是为了提高开发效率和代码质量。良好的代码设计可以减少冗余,提升可读性和可维护性,降低后期修改成本。它还能增强系统的稳定性和扩展性,使团队协作更顺畅。通过合理设计,代码更易测试和调试,最终加快项目交付速度。

  • 微信网址多少钱

    微信网址的价格因服务商和具体服务内容而异,通常包括注册费和年费。基础域名注册可能在几十到几百元不等,而带有特定后缀或短网址的微信网址可能更贵。建议在选择时比较不同服务商的价格和服务质量,确保性价比。

    2025-06-11
    04
  • 如何做wap网站

    制作WAP网站首先需选择合适的建站工具,如WordPress或Wix,确保其支持移动端优化。其次,设计简洁直观的界面,优先考虑用户体验,使用响应式设计确保在不同设备上均能良好显示。最后,进行SEO优化,包括关键词布局、加载速度提升等,确保网站在搜索引擎中排名靠前。

  • ai如何绘制徽章

    AI绘制徽章可通过以下步骤实现:首先,使用Adobe Illustrator等矢量绘图软件打开AI工具。接着,选择合适的形状工具绘制徽章的基本轮廓,如圆形或盾形。然后,利用颜色填充和渐变工具为徽章添加色彩和立体感。最后,添加文字或符号细节,调整图层顺序,确保整体设计协调美观。保存为矢量格式,便于后续使用。

  • 什么是数据短信

    数据短信是一种通过移动网络传输的数据信息,不同于普通文字短信,它可包含图片、音频、视频等多媒体内容。广泛应用于营销推广、验证码发送等领域,具有信息量大、形式多样等优点。

  • 如何申请bgp

    申请BGP(边界网关协议)需要先确定你的网络需求,选择合适的ISP(互联网服务提供商)。提交申请时,需提供公司资质、网络架构图及IP地址规划。ISP审核通过后,进行BGP配置,包括ASN(自治系统号)申请和路由策略设置。确保网络设备支持BGP协议,并测试连通性,最终完成BGP部署。

  • 网站需要会什么

    网站需要具备良好的用户体验、快速的加载速度、简洁的导航结构和高品质的内容。用户体验直接影响访客停留时间,加载速度影响搜索引擎排名,导航结构帮助用户快速找到所需信息,内容质量则是吸引和留住用户的关键。

    2025-06-19
    0195

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注